31 | ;; Set standard fontname specification of characters in the default |
32 | ;; fontset to find an appropriate font for each charset. This is used | |
33 | ;; to generate a font name for a fontset if the fontset doesn't | |
34 | ;; specify a font name for a specific character. The specification | |
35 | ;; has the form (FAMILY . REGISTRY). FAMILY may be nil, in which | |
36 | ;; case, the family name of default face is used. If REGISTRY | |
37 | ;; contains a character `-', the string before that is embedded in | |
38 | ;; `CHARSET_REGISTRY' field, and the string after that is embedded in | |
39 | ;; `CHARSET_ENCODING' field. If it does not contain `-', the whole | |
40 | ;; string is embedded in `CHARSET_REGISTRY' field, and a wild card | |
41 | ;; character `*' is embedded in `CHARSET_ENCODING' field. The | |
42 | ;; REGISTRY for ASCII characters are predefined as "ISO8859-1". | |

278 | ;; Regular expression matching against a fontname which conforms to | |
279 | ;; XLFD (X Logical Font Description). All fields in XLFD should be | |
280 | ;; not be omitted (but can be a wild card) to be matched. | |
281 | (defconst xlfd-tight-regexp | |
282 | "^\ | |
283 | -\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)\ | |
284 | -\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)\ | |
285 | -\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)-\\([^-]*\\)$") | |
286 | ||
287 | ;; List of field numbers of XLFD whose values are numeric. | |
288 | (defconst xlfd-regexp-numeric-subnums | |
289 | (list xlfd-regexp-pixelsize-subnum ;6 | |
290 | xlfd-regexp-pointsize-subnum ;7 | |
291 | xlfd-regexp-resx-subnum ;8 | |
292 | xlfd-regexp-resy-subnum ;9 | |
293 | xlfd-regexp-avgwidth-subnum ;11 | |
294 | )) | |
295 | ||
296 | (defun x-decompose-font-name (pattern) | |
297 | "Decompose PATTERN into XLFD's fields and return vector of the fields. | |
298 | The length of the vector is 14. | |
299 | ||
300 | If PATTERN doesn't conform to XLFD, try to get a full XLFD name from | |
301 | X server and use the information of the full name to decompose | |
302 | PATTERN. If no full XLFD name is gotten, return nil." | |
